Deer Struck by Vehicle, Wildlife Hazard at Old Arcata Road and Graham Road
AI SUMMARY: At 6:25 pm, a dispatch to the California Highway Patrol reported a animal hazard at the intersection of Old Arcata Road and Graham Road. A deer was spotted on the right-hand side of the road, with a large buck in the roadway. There were reports that the deer may have been hit by a car, and additional callers mentioned that the deer was attempting to crawl into the road. A vehicle was reported to have hit the deer and continued on. The dispatch confirmed that the deer needed to be dispatched and taken care of.
